**A Glimpse into History:**

The origins of the Patna Mahavir Mandir trace back to ancient times. It is said that the temple was built during the 18th century by Swami Balanand, a revered saint and devotee of Lord Hanuman. Over the years, the temple complex has undergone several renovations and expansions, resulting in the magnificent structure that stands today.

**Spiritual Significance:**

The temple is dedicated to Lord Hanuman, the revered monkey god known for his unwavering devotion and strength. Devotees from all walks of life visit the temple to seek the blessings of Lord Hanuman, especially on Tuesdays and Saturdays — considered auspicious days for worship. The serene ambiance of the temple complex creates an atmosphere of tranquility, making it an ideal place for meditation and self-reflection.

**Architectural Marvel:**

The architecture of the Patna Mahavir Mandir is a blend of traditional Indian styles with intricate designs that showcase the craftsmanship of yesteryears. The main sanctum enshrines a colossal idol of Lord Hanuman, which is a sight to behold. The temple's facade features ornate carvings and sculptures depicting scenes from Hindu mythology, captivating visitors with its artistic beauty.

**Cultural Heritage and Festivals:**

Beyond its religious significance, the Patna Mahavir Mandir is a cultural hub that hosts various festivals and events throughout the year. Hanuman Jayanti, the birthday of Lord Hanuman, is celebrated with great fervor, attracting throngs of devotees who participate in processions, prayers, and devotional songs. These events not only deepen the spiritual connection but also bring the community together.

**A Beacon of Hope:**

The temple is not just a place of worship; it also serves as a center of compassion and service. The temple management and devotees often engage in charitable activities, including organizing free food distribution for the underprivileged and providing medical assistance to those in need. This spirit of selflessness and giving adds to the temple's significance in the lives of the people.
